Stephen Strahm German/Amazon EROS
I'm very excited to share with you all this lovely build for Miki Gakki in Japan. There are some cool features new to me which include a stunning bearclaw German Spruce top, solid wood rosette ring, figured Ebony overlay, and Bloodwood purfles. I hope you enjoy the show!
EROS specs: • Top- Bearclaw German Spruce • Body- Amazon Rosewood • Finish- Nitrocellulose Lacquer • Frets to the body- 14 • scale- 25.375" • Nut width- 1 3/4" • String spacing at saddle- 2 1/4" • Neck- Honduran Mahogany w/ 2-way adjustable trussrod • Purfling- Bloodwood • Bindings- West African Ebony • Headstock veneer- Figured West African Ebony • Position markers- Gold MOP side dots only • Rosette- Amazon Rosewood • Fretboard- West African Ebony • Bridge- West African Ebony • Tuners- Cosmo Black Gotoh 510's • Nut and saddle- Unbleached bone • Case- Main Stage |

For this build I'm doing a more traditional style rosette which is a first on my guitars. The design is a single ring and I've made the inner portion out of Amazon Rosewood to match the back & sides. I do a two step process which I find yields a clean result. Here I've made the solid ring and inlayed it into the top. Tomorrow I'll cut the inner and outer purfle channels, then glue the purfles in.
